Madeline L'Engle 1918-2007


Another great author has left the world. I used to love the Wrinkle in Time books. I remember reading them to Warren, next to Harry Potter and Jabberwocky {He is his mother's son after all} they were his favorite books.Everytime I think of them it brings back memories of putting him to bed when he was little and still wanted mom to tuck him in and read to him {He kill me for telling you this, but sometimes he still likes me to tuck him in and read to him. but shhh I didn't tell you that. He's 14 and got a rep to protect you know}


Like me he's always loved a fantasy that is as much of the mind as it is of the physical.


I didn't realize she was 88, for some reason I always thought she was younger than that. I guess the books were written earlier than I had thought. {IWhich makes her also a ground breaker as fantasy and scifi have a underserved reputation for being a male genre, which couldn't be farther from the truth.


She will live on forever in the hearts and minds of kids {to say nothing of kids at heart} forever.
